But a mere hour away is what the Los Angeles Daily Herald (a mere century ago!) called “The Gem of the Continent”: Redondo Beach. 100-years later, Redondo Beach is still a gem. One of three coastal towns of the South Bay known as the Beach Cities, Redondo Beach is the epitome of California beach-living. In fact, it was here where surfing was first introduced to Californians by American surfing pioneer, George Freeth.

Today, surfers are joined by bikers, paddleboarders, volleyball players, and scores of folks enjoying life under the sun, on the shore and over the water walking Redondo’s famous “endless” pier. A decidedly contemporary vibe, The Portofino has a near 60-year history in Redondo Beach. It even has its own glamorous past having been the west coast finish line of the famed, cross-country Cannonball Run race in 1971, later made into a movie. Its racing roots trace back to its racecar-loving founder, Mary Davis, and to the many Formula-1 drivers who made this a favorite hideaway.
